WebSep 21, 2024 · Ibuprofen is included on websites and frequently referenced lists as medium risk for inducing hemolysis in children with glucose-6-phosphate dehydrogenase (G6PD) deficiency. This presents a challenge for otolaryngologists who perform tonsillectomy and other surgeries in children, as ibuprofen serves as an important alternative to opioids for ... Discussion Glucose-6-phosphate dehydrogenase (G6PD) is an enzyme that helps defend red blood cells against oxidative stress, thus deficiency can cause hemolytic anemia. G6PD deficiency is the world's most common enzyme deficiency and affects more than 400 million people. WebSep 21, 2024 · There is scant, low-quality evidence of hemolytic anemia caused by ibuprofen in children with G6PD deficiency. WebSep 26, 2024 · Introduction. Glucose-6-phosphate dehydrogenase (G6PD) is an enzyme found in the cytoplasm of all cells in the body. It is a housekeeping enzyme that plays a vital role in the prevention of cellular damage from reactive oxygen species (ROS). It does this by providing substrates to prevent oxidative damage.
